On Sun, Nov 02, 2014 at 11:22:12AM +0100, Tomasz Pala wrote: > While both K8 and F10h are AMD64 CPUs, EDAC doesn't require them to run > in long mode; AMD_NB dependency is enough.
Not enabling it on 32-bit was a conscious decision for the simple reason that with the current DIMM sizes, you can have 1 or 2 DIMMs tops which you can use on 32-bit and having a fat driver mapping memory errors to DIMMs in that case does seem like a waste of time, energy, resources... you name it.
I guess I'll add a note about this in the Kconfig text because I keep getting patches about this once every couple of months :-)
